When a service desk analyst opens the Service Desk console to assist someone, the recent requests of that requester are immediately visible to that analyst. Until now, the open request were shown first, and then the completed requests. The algorithm that decides this ordering has now been changed. First, requests with status ‘Waiting for Customer’ are displayed. Then, requests are shown ordered by the date on which they were opened or completed. This way, requests that were completed recently appear higher than they used to. This makes sense, as oftentimes people contact the service desk with question about recently completed requests.
